How do we know God's promises to Abraham include Gentiles?

Answered in 1 source

God's promises to Abraham extend to Gentiles through Christ, who is the seed mentioned in Scripture.

The Apostle Paul makes it explicit in Galatians 3 that the blessing of Abraham comes to the Gentiles through Christ. In Galatians 3:13-14, it states that Christ redeemed us from the curse of the law to ensure that the blessing given to Abraham might come to the Gentiles through Jesus Christ. This underscores the continuity of God's redemptive plan, where the promise of salvation is not limited to ethnic Israel but is extended to all nations, fulfilling God's promise to Abraham of making him a father of many nations through the singular seed, which is Christ.
Scripture References: Galatians 3:13-14
